If you want to sell the old bike, here are six important points to consider before selling it.

Paperwork is one of the most important legalities to be performed while selling second-hand products. Thus, ensure that you have all the necessary documents prepared before you sell bike online. These documents would include ownership documents, sales agreement with all the terms and conditions, registration certificate (RC), regional transport office tax details (RTO), test drive agreement before the sale, and NOC if the vehicle was purchased at a loan.

All the issues with the bike must be cleared before you sell used bike as it would give you much better negotiations with the price. So, get your bike assessed with a professional mechanic that might fix all the prevailing issues in the bike while servicing it. Also, if the buyer wants a test drive, a serviced bike would give a much better result than a non-serviced one.

After completing all the necessary paperwork, the last task will be to transfer all the papers to the new ownership, including bike insurance. Doing this would legally ensure that the seller holds no rights on the bike whatsoever and would make the buyer completely responsible for it.

Before selling your bike, ensure the correct resale value of your bike as the market goes up and down daily, and so do the prices of bikes. When you know the correct value of your bike, you will negotiate well with the potential buyer. Sometimes the low resale value of the brand also contributes to the low resale prices of the bike. So, before stepping out, research or contact a verified bike trader to get the correct number.

Visuals matter a lot when buying and selling online, as it is the first step to attract customers. Thus, you should get the perfect pictures of your bike from multiple angles to get a buyer quickly.
